MySQL数据库安装步骤详解MySQL是一款广泛使用的开源关系数据库管理系统,因其高性能、可靠性和易于使用而受到众多开发者和企业的青睐。本文将详细介绍如何在Liux环境下安装MySQL数据库,包括从下载安装包到配置数据库的完整过程。标签:准备工作在开始安装MySQL之前,请确保您的系统满足以下要求: 操作系统:Liux(如CeOS
MySQL是一款广泛使用的开源关系数据库管理系统,因其高性能、可靠性和易于使用而受到众多开发者和企业的青睐。本文将详细介绍如何在Liux环境下安装MySQL数据库,包括从下载安装包到配置数据库的完整过程。 在开始安装MySQL之前,请确保您的系统满足以下要求: 操作系统:Liux(如CeOS、Ubuu等) 安装工具:ar(用于解压安装包) 用户权限:具有roo权限或sudo权限的用户 首先,您需要从MySQL官方网站下载适合您操作系统的MySQL安装包。以下是下载步骤: 访问MySQL官方网站:hps://dev.mysql.com/dowloads/ 选择“MySQL Commuiy Server”选项卡。 选择适合您的操作系统和架构的版本。 点击“Dowload”按钮,下载安装包。 下载完成后,使用以下命令解压安装包: 将解压后的文件夹移动到系统目录下,例如: 创建一个专门用于运行MySQL服务的系统用户: 为MySQL文件夹和配置文件设置适当的用户权限: 编辑MySQL配置文件(/ec/my.cf),设置服务器和客户端参数: 在您的shell配置文件(如.bashrc或.zshrc)中添加以下行,以便在命令行中直接使用MySQL命令: 保存并关闭文件,然后使用以下命令使更改生效: 初始化MySQL数据库,创建数据目录和系统数据库: 将MySQL设置为系统服务,以便在启动和关闭系统时自动启动和关闭MySQL服务: 使用以下命令为roo用户设置密码: 按照提示输入新密码,并确认密码。 登录MySQL数据库,并配置roo用户的远程访问权限: 执行以下命令,允许roo用户远程登录: 执行以下命令,刷新权限: 退出MySQL:MySQL数据库安装步骤详解
标签:准备工作
标签:下载MySQL安装包
标签:解压安装包
ar -xf mysql-8.0.33-el7-x8664.ar.gz
标签:移动安装文件夹
mv mysql-8.0.33-el7-x8664 mysql
mv mysql /usr/local/
标签:创建MySQL用户
useradd -s /sbi/ologi mysql
标签:设置权限
chow -R mysql:mysql /usr/local/mysql/
chow mysql:mysql /ec/my.cf
标签:配置MySQL
[clie]por = 3306socke = /usr/local/mysql/mysql.sock[mysqld]user = mysqlbasedir = /usr/local/mysqldaadir = /usr/local/mysql/daapor = 3306
标签:设置环境变量
expor PATH=$PATH:/usr/local/mysql/bi
source ~/.bashrc
(或source ~/.zshrc,根据您的shell配置文件而定)标签:初始化数据库
cd /usr/local/mysql/bi
./mysqld --iiialize --user=mysql
标签:设置系统服务
sysemcl eable mysqld
sysemcl sar mysqld
标签:设置roo密码
mysql_secure_isallaio
标签:登录MySQL并配置远程访问
mysql -u roo -p
GRAT ALL PRIVILEGES O . TO 'roo'@'%' IDETIFIED BY 'your_password';
FLUSH PRIVILEGES;
EXIT;
至此,您已完成MySQL数据库的安装和配置。接下来,您可以根据需要创建数据库、用户和